From: Tim X <timx@spamto.devnul.com>
Subject: Re: Link between two buffers
Date: 28 Jul 2005 08:50:46 +1000 [thread overview]
Message-ID: <87ek9jzwvt.fsf@tiger.rapttech.com.au> (raw)
In-Reply-To: uu0ig6jo7.fsf@fgeorges.org
drkm <usenet@fgeorges.org> writes:
> Pascal Bourguignon writes:
>
> > drkm <usenet@fgeorges.org> writes:
>
> >> Pascal Bourguignon writes:
>
> >>> There is follow-mode which does it vertically. Perhaps you could hack
> >>> it to do it also horizontally, depending on how the windows are split
> >>> when starting it...
>
> >> Why "depending on how the windows are split"? 'follow-mode'
> >> could follow both horizontaly and verticaly, isn't it?
>
> > No it cannot follow horizontally.
> > Try it:
>
> Yes, I know. But if someone hack it to provide horizontal
> following, what do you want to do "depending on how the windows
> are split"? Why don't just have 'follow-mode' following both
> horizontally and vertically (in the case of horizontal following
> available)?
>
It may be a little more difficult to get follow-mode to do that - but
must admit I need to think it out more - just seems to be something
bugging me and that feeling we have overlooked something - a window
has to be at least 1 line in height and at least 1 column in width. It
strikes me that its probably not too difficult to ensure the line the
cursor is on is visible in both windows, especially if you don't
really care about cursor position within the line - would doing the
same when you have a window which is just one column (and possible 1
row) in size be a problem?
However, as the only reason the OP wants this behavior is so
that he can see the header line of the file at the same time as
viewing row data which is more than one window in distance from the
header line in his file, I'm thinking he is probably better off
forgetting about follow-mode and seeing how hard it would be to create
a mode which puts the first line into a header line (such as those
used in *info* mode) and allows the rest of the buffer window to be
used to scroll through the data file?
Tim
--
Tim Cross
The e-mail address on this message is FALSE (obviously!). My real e-mail is
to a company in Australia called rapttech and my login is tcross - if you
really need to send mail, you should be able to work it out!
next prev parent reply other threads:[~2005-07-27 22:50 UTC|newest]
Thread overview: 8+ messages / expand[flat|nested] mbox.gz Atom feed top
2005-07-27 8:54 Link between two buffers Marc Tfardy
2005-07-27 8:57 ` Pascal Bourguignon
2005-07-27 18:36 ` drkm
2005-07-27 20:14 ` Pascal Bourguignon
2005-07-27 21:08 ` drkm
2005-07-27 22:50 ` Tim X [this message]
2005-07-28 21:48 ` Marc Tfardy
-- strict thread matches above, loose matches on Subject: below --
2005-07-28 22:30 b.jc-emacs
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
List information: https://www.gnu.org/software/emacs/
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=87ek9jzwvt.fsf@tiger.rapttech.com.au \
--to=timx@spamto.devnul.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for read-only IMAP folder(s) and NNTP newsgroup(s).